oke restart your computer.
after that press F5 while the computer tryingn to on,
choose safe mode option athe first of screen
wait untill your windows, splash in safe modeyou
click start, choose Run.
type C:\WINDOWS\system32\Restore\rstrui.exe
enter, select restore my computer to in early time, next
you can choose the date, when your computer in good condition
next
next
wait, it restart automaticly
i hope it can solve your problem
